Atuin replaces boring history with something smart:

  • Full-screen fuzzy search (rebind Ctrl-R, or arrow up).
  • All commands stored in SQLite, not a flat text file.
  • Encrypted sync across machines.
  • History per session, per directory, or global.
  • Knows exit code, duration, cwd, hostname… even stats of “most used commands.”

Example:

# search through all your history
atuin search docker build

# fuzzy jump back to a command and run it
Ctrl-R → type "kubectl logs"

I open a new laptop → log into Atuin → my history is already there. Magic.

Bonus: it doesn’t delete your old history file, just makes it better. Supported shells: zsh, bash, fish, nushell, xonsh.
